The world of data analytics has witnessed a significant surge in attention in recent years, with businesses and individuals increasingly relying on data-driven insights to make informed decisions. Data math, the underlying engine of this phenomenon, has become a hot topic of discussion across various industries. From marketing to finance, healthcare to social media, the application of data math is revolutionizing the way we understand and interact with data.

In the US, data math is gaining attention due to the increasing availability of data, advancements in technology, and the growing need for data-driven decision-making. As a result, businesses are seeking to develop a strong data foundation to remain competitive in the market. This has led to a significant increase in the demand for data professionals and a growing need for education and training programs that teach data math skills.

It's a multidisciplinary field that combines elements of statistics, machine learning, and programming to identify patterns, trends, and correlations. Data math can be used to answer various questions, such as identifying customer behavior, predicting market trends, and optimizing business processes.
